Introducing Showpad Content and Veloxy

Showpad Content, Veloxy, Showpad, Seismic, etc., belong to a category of solutions that help Sales Enablement. Different products excel in different areas, so the best platform for your business will depend on your specific needs and requirements.

Showpad Content covers Content Management, Engagement Management, Sales Document Management, Collaboration with Offline, etc.

Veloxy focuses on Communication Management with E-Mail, Engagement Management with E-Mail, Generation Of New Leads with Phone Calls, Lead Tracking with E-Mail, etc.
